Wisconsin State Dept. of Public Instruction, Madison. Div. of Library Services. – 1981
In the spring of 1980, the State of Wisconsin Division for Library Services conducted a survey to determine the level of children's services offered by public libraries throughout the state. Questionnaires were sent to the 435 public library units in the state offering library services, and 363 of these responded to the survey. Cross tabulations…

Peer reviewedVoice of Youth Advocates, 1999
In the basement of the Waupaca Area Public Library, the Best Cellar is a separate room for young adults that allows teens the freedom to laugh, talk, snack, and listen to music without disturbing others. The furniture, collection, young adult population and community, hours of operation, staffing, planning, youth participation, and librarian and…

Merrill-Oldham, Jan – 1985
This kit is the result of a written request for sample materials from 35 ARL (Association of Research Libraries) members known to have active preservation programs. Twenty-three libraries responded, and of those, 16 contributed documents--some of which are included here. This kit contains: four preservation-related policy statements; 32 examples…
